Wild new video shows a gunman opening fire in the middle of a Bronx street that left another man wounded.

The clip, released late Wednesday, shows the suspect walking between parked cars on Holland Avenue near East 212th Street in Olinville just before 11 a.m. Nov. 10 and darting into the middle of the empty street, where he let off a few rounds.

He is then shown running across the street, between two other cars and firing again on the sidewalk. 

His target, a 36-year-old man, was shot in the stomach and leg, and was taken to Jacobi Medical Center in stable condition, cops said.

Police said the victim was uncooperative with investigators. The motive for the gunplay was unclear Thursday.

Property damage was reported to unattended parked vehicles.

The suspect, described as a man with a dark complexion, was last seen wearing a black and blue knit hat, blue long-sleeve shirt, black vest, blue-colored pants, dark-colored shoes and a light-colored backpack.
